All My Friends, is a one-woman wrecking ball of punk ferocity and undeniable hooks, led by LGBTQ songwriter Christina Picciano. Based out of Westchester County, New York.

She has been hard at work on the band’s upcoming full-length record. Along the way, she has left a trail of breadcrumbs, including the singles “Pennsylvania,” 
Do You Want Me?” and the recently banned from TikTok Anti-Trump single “How Could You?” Now, Picciano is releasing her brand new queer rallying cry, “Tourmaline.”

With towering riffs and a call for all creeps to back-the-fuck-off, Picciano describes the song as “bubble gum grunge with bite — a fierce, queer anthem about reclaiming your energy from an ‘energy vampire.'” adding that “it’s a cathartic protection spell in song form.”
